5-Hydroxytryptophan vs Valerian Root Extract
amino acid
5-Hydroxytryptophan has 142 products from 83 brands with an average dosage of 104.07 mg. Valerian Root Extract has 82 products from 58 brands with an average dosage of 287.24 mg. There are 8 products containing both.
